Uniform Commercial Code
A comprehensive set of laws governing commercial transactions in the United States, intended to standardize practices and streamline interstate commerce.
Unilateral Contract
A contract where only one party promises a reward in exchange for the performance of a specific act by the other party.
Contract Formality
Contract formality refers to the requisite legal formalities and procedures, such as written documentation or specific terms, necessary for a contract to be considered valid and enforceable.
Quasi Contract
A legal concept where courts impose a contract-like obligation on a party to prevent unjust enrichment, even though no real contract exists between the parties involved.
